setMnemonic() et appeler une méthode en appuyant sur la touche
J'ai d'exécuter une méthode() manuellement en appuyant sur la touche (Alt+H).
if("The key pressed==(Alt+H)"){
callMethod();
}
public void callMethod(){
//Some codes here
}
Comment je peux faire ça en Java. Merci de me donner un moyen simple de faire cela.
Vous devez vous connecter pour publier un commentaire.
Il est intéressant de lire ici à propos de Oracle Tutoriel D'Activation Du Clavier De L'Opération où il est expliqué en détails le long de l'échantillon.
En savoir plus sur la Oracle Tutoriel - Comment faire pour Utiliser les raccourcis clavier
Quelques exemple directement à partir du tutoriel ci-dessus:
Lire la suite ici Oracle Tutoriel - Comment faire pour Utiliser des Boutons, des Cases à Cocher et des Boutons Radio
Exemple de code: (
Alt-H
cliquez sur le bouton du Milieu)Si utilisation des menus vous pouvez ensuite utiliser
setMnemonic()
, voir Comment Utiliser les Menus pour des exemples. Une autre option est d'utiliser Les Raccourcis Clavier. Par exemple:Meilleure méthode est d'utiliser setMnemonic() parce que c'est le plus simple.
vérifier cet article pour plus d' http://www.herongyang.com/Swing/JMenuBar-Set-Keyboard-Mnemonics-on-Menu-Items.html